>> There had been a instance where we had to drive different resolution
>> (lower) than the native one. Also in VBT there is a field to make this
>> generic at least from driver perspective to give the needed target
>> resolution. In case target resolution is same as native, nothing gets
>> changed, else mode_fixup function adjusts the mode accordingly keeping
>> timing as same and enabling scalar. Might not be useful in general, but
>> did find a use internally.
>
> Can we just have the driver return the desired mode from .get_modes in
> that case?

Okay, I think I did not explain correctly. Get modes is modified to give 
the needed target mode only so that userspace creates buffer of the 
needed resolution, but in fixup which is called at modeset, we correct 
the adjusted_mode back to have native resolutions so that modeset is 
correctly done. if we do not do like this, during modeset resolutions 
will be wrong as per the timings.
